About the role

To assist the pharmacist with the preparation and dispensing of medications. Deliver the medications to the nurse, patient, medication room, storage location, or automated dispensing machine. Interviews patients and/or family members in order to obtain and document patients’ medication histories in the Aultman Hospital information system, Cerner Millennium. Retrieves and delivers discharge medication prescriptions for/to patients.

Qualifications

  • Must be at least 18 years of age
  • High school diploma or equivalent GED is required
  • Associate or Bachelor’s degree in college is preferred
  • Candidate must be registered as a Technician Trainee, Registered Pharmacy Technician, or Certified Pharmacy Technician with the Ohio Board of Pharmacy
  • All Trainee and Registered Technicians will be expected to become licensed as a Certified Pharmacy Technician once training is complete
  • Applicant must pass a national certification examination (PTCB or ExCPT) at time of hire or within the first 90 days of employment if not already completed
  • Licence must be in good standing
  • Applicable background checks must be passed
  • Prior experience, in retail pharmacy, nursing home pharmacy, or hospital pharmacy is preferred
  • Must be proficient in the use of computers to input patient billing data
